Geometric tolerancing controls geometric characteristics of parts such as circularity, runout, position, etc.
Geometric Tolerancing
A system that defines and specifies engineering tolerances based on geometric shapes and features, improving interchangeability and quality.
Circularity
A geometric tolerance that limits the deviation of an object’s form from being a perfect circle.
Runout
A term that describes the maximum deviation or variation of an object from its intended perfect form or the total movement of a rotational part.
